NATO Intern Arrested in Belgium on Suspicion of Espionage

Belgian prosecutors have arrested a Canadian citizen of Chinese origin working as an intern at NATO headquarters in Belgium, suspecting her of espionage for a third country and involvement in a criminal organization.
According to the International Desk of Webangah News Agency, Belgian prosecutors announced on Saturday that a Canadian woman of Chinese descent, who was interning at NATO‘s military headquarters in Belgium, has been apprehended on charges of espionage. The Federal Prosecutor’s Office stated in a release that she is suspected of spying for a third country and being part of a criminal organization. The statement further indicated that the woman was employed as an intern at the Supreme Headquarters Allied Powers Europe (SHAPE), a NATO command center located in Mons, Belgium. No further details regarding her identity or the name of the country and organization she is suspected of spying for were provided in the statement.
